You will join our Geostructures department:
As our new Senior Geotechnical Engineer you will be part of a growing team focused on the delivery of challenging ground engineering schemes that support and enable the construction of new railways, ports, renewable energy facilities, highways, and high quality new buildings.  We also advise clients on the impact of new work on the existing natural and man-made environment to enable new projects to proceed in a sustainable and safe manner. This is recently established team but contains engineers who are experts in their field and will be able to guide and develop your career as you add new skills to those you bring to Geostructures.

Your key tasks and responsibilities will be:

  • Providing geostructures advice and design to a multi-disciplinary project team taking technical geotechnical delivery for projects or sections of large infrastructure schemes
  • Planning and conducting Geostructures analysis using various proprietary tools
  • Guiding less experienced engineers to deliver analysis and design.
  • Providing new ideas or approaches to ground engineering challenges.
  • Carrying out research and development of new ideas and products to enable Ramboll to provide sustainable solutions for society.
  • Assist in marketing our skills to identify and secure exciting new projects and contracts that build on our existing industry and market relationships. 

Your starting point for constant growth
From the moment you join Ramboll, we will support your personal and professional development so that you grow with the company. For this role, we believe your starting point is:

  • Minimum of 8 years working experience.
  • Good quality BEng degree with reasonable geotechnical engineering or engineering geology content. 
  • A masters degree or higher that focuses on geotechnical engineering or engineering geology would be of benefit.
  • Proven ability to carry out complex analyses retaining structures or complex foundations.
  • Past experience of rock engineering and/or geo-seismic engineering would be a benefit.
  • Knowledge and demonstrable experience of the use of Python to solve technical problems.
  • Written and oral communication skills in Danish is beneficial for this role but not essential.
  • Good written and oral communication skills in English.
  • Good appreciation of the commercial controls needed to deliver work in a manner that meets our business objectives.

Personal qualities that will help you succeed in this role include the ability to investigate new ideas and not rely on tried and trusted methods; good oral communication skills to enable interaction with colleagues of varying experience and background, both in person and online; ability to interrogate your own work and that of others to ensure that delivery is accurate and meets our high standards.

Ramboll in Denmark
Ramboll is a leading engineering, architecture, and consultancy company founded in Denmark in 1945, with more than 18,000 employees globally. In Denmark, we are 4.100 colleagues delivering innovative solutions within Buildings, Transport, Water, Environment & Health, Energy and Management Consulting.
